Product information "Otoflash Plexi tray"
The Otoflash Plexi Tray is an accessory specially developed for the Otoflash G171, designed for safe and effective post-processing of your 3D printed models. It serves as a holder for your printed pieces during the curing process and at the same time ensures optimum protection for the curing equipment.
The Otoflash Plexi tray is made of high-quality Plexiglas, which is known for its robustness and durability. This material is resistant to the intense light and heat exposure during the curing process, protecting the quality and integrity of your 3D printed models.
The design of the Otoflash Plexi tray allows for easy handling and optimal illumination of your printed pieces. It offers sufficient space for several models and enables even curing from all sides. The transparent Plexiglas structure also allows a clear view of the models during the curing process so that you can monitor the progress at all times.
The Otoflash Plexi tray is easy to install and remove, making it easy to maintain and clean your Otoflash G171. It is easy to clean and effectively resists resin and colour residue, helping to maintain the operating condition and performance of your Otoflash G171.
